Adams was appointed the new manager at Port Vale in June
Port Vale's players have been formally introduced to new manager Micky Adams on their return to pre-season training.
Adams held a meeting with the squad on Wednesday where he told them pre-season is a time when each individual player has to go it alone.
He told BBC Radio Stoke: "Although it's a team game, from a footballer's point of view pre-season is a time when you are self-employed."
Adams returned to club management in June after a second spell at Brighton.
The former Fulham and Leicester City boss is currently working on his own at Vale Park but he intends to fill the club's vacant player-coach role.
Adams is not being drawn on a time-scale for the appointment but he has confirmed he will be talking to a couple of potential candidates before the end of this week.
The start of pre-season training also saw the squad welcome three new recruits Adam Yates, Doug Loft and Tom Fraser.
